Alyssa ’s Reviews > Squeeze Me > Status Update

Alyssa
Alyssa is 75% done
Sep 16, 2025 05:49PM
Squeeze Me

1 like ·  flag

Alyssa ’s Previous Updates

Alyssa
Alyssa is 30% done
Sep 16, 2025 03:25AM
Squeeze Me


No comments have been added yet.